GSCI 315 - Principles of Geochemistry


2018-2019 Catalog Year

Credit(s): 3
Lecture: 3
Non-Lecture: 0
The application of the basic principles of chemistry to the study of geologic processes. Topics include the origin and distribution of the chemical elements, the fundamentals of crystal chemistry, the important chemical reactions occurring in low-temperature aqueous solutions, and the construction and interpretation of mineral-stability diagrams.

Prerequisite(s): GSCI 220 , CHEM 119 , and (CHEM 118  or CHEM 204 ) or permission of instructor.
Offered: When demand is sufficient
